Guru Analysis for Hewlett Packard Enterprise Company (HPE)
Hewlett Packard Enterprise Company (HPE), a key player in the Technology sector, continues to attract institutional attention.
As of Q2 2026, a total of 14 Super Investors (Gurus) hold positions in the company, with a combined stake valued at approximately $1.17 B.
Top institutional holders include Cliff Asness and Steven Cohen.
Institutional sentiment is currently Bearish. This is evidenced by a $117.55 M net outflow during the quarter.
Recent activity highlights Steven Cohen who opened a new position. Conversely, Ray Dalio reduced exposure by 94.7%.
